Provide all supervision, labor, plant, equipment, materials, and all other things necessary to make Emergency Temporary Roof Repairs for Homes/Buildings damaged by Hurricane Frances, State of Florida by: 1) installing Government-Furnished plastic; 2) furni shing and installing structural panels; 3) furnishing and installing joists and rafters, and 4) preparing submittals. Estimated duration for this effort is 90 calendar days. As a minimum, the Contractor shall repair at least 2,000 roofs per day. The con tracts will be Fixed-Price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ity with a Guaranteed Minimum of $5,000. Multiple Awards will be made for up to five (5) contracts with a Maximum value of $250,000,000.00 per contract. This solicitation is unrestricted. T he NAICS Code assigned is 236220 with a Size Standard of $28,500,000.00. This procurement will be advertised as a Best Value, Request for Proposal. The evaluation criteria will be in the solicitation package. All responsible sources may submit a proposa l, which shall be considered by the agency. Large business firms are required to submit a subcontracting plan at the time of proposal submission. NOTE #1: This solicitation is being issued subject to availability of funds to be provided by FEMA.
